MN FCCLA Chapters may affiliate as an FCCLA Chapter (any grade) or an FCCLA Middle-level chapter.

FCCLA Chapter (Any Grade)

  • Membership dues for a member are a total of $20.00. (State=$11 and National=$9.00)
  • A minimum chapter is 12 members or $240
  • There is an online process with National FCCLA for Affiliation and Roster.

FCCLA Middle-level chapter (Middle-Level Grades)

  • Membership dues for a middle-level chapter affiliated in a lump sum are possible. This fee is $250.00 national dues. Any number of students may be named on the affiliation roster. Up to 500 members are counted for this chapter. This is only available for middle-level students.
  • Send in the middle-level affiliation form and Roster.
  • MN FCCLA is a direct affiliation state with online affiliations with national FCCLA.
  • Membership affiliation is needed to participate in FCCLA events and Competitive Events.

Membership Dues:

All affiliations must be an affiliated with the national website online system before students can be registered for STAR Events.

Incentives Categories:

  1. If your chapter increased your membership by 7 more members than your last year’s numbers, you have already achieved the 7-Up Challenge.  For example- if you chapter had 14 members last year, your chapter would need to increase to 21 members this year!
  2. If 33.3% of students in your school are members of your FCCLA chapter you have already completed the 7-Up Challenge.  Chapter advisors must notify the state office of this before March 1st.
  3. If your chapter retained the same number of members that it had last year your chapter has the option of purchasing tickets for $5.00 per person for the  State Conference event.
  4. If your chapter is affiliated as a Middle Level or Co-Curricular chapter, you have already completed the 7-Up Challenge.  By affiliating all classroom students in FCCLA.
